We were there on a July weekday in the late morning. Parking was plentiful. There are two parts to the dog park, a small dog portion and a larger dog portion. We have a mini Australian shepherd and chose the large dog portion. There was already a lab there, and our dog was happy to play with him. There's plenty of room to run and there are benches for people to sit under a shade tree. We and our dog had a good time. We've been before and we'll be back.

I'm not a big fan of Elm Street dog park, but I drop by occasionally. Poo bags and water are available. You can park on Elm Street or in the parking lot off Ash Street. There's a section for big dogs and a smaller section for little dogs, and both have double gate entrances and benches. It's my experience that the people in the small dog section go a little bananas when there's the slightest scuffle. I don't mean aggression, just a normal sorting out of who's who among the dogs. If your little dog is 100% passive, you will be welcomed. We use the big dog section if there are only a few dogs present, so she can run and play more rambunctiously. If the big dogs ovewhelm her, we leave. This dog park isn't the best fit for my dog but I support it wholeheartedly. There are so few places we can take our pups off leash, and Elm Street dog park might be perfect for you and your dog.

Clean, well kept dog park. Large fenced area for big dogs and small fenced area for small dogs. Grass and shade trees with plenty of benches to rest. Lots of water bowls and an area for dog toys. Playground is nearby so kids can also play while your doggies do
We take our Dog to the Elm Street Dog park at least 3 times a week. There is a section for the little dogs and larger dogs. All owners care for their own dogs and everyone is friendly. There is water for the dogs and seating for people if they want. Poopoo bags are on site too and its a very clean dog park
This is a nice big park. It has separate big dog and small dog areas. Also has some nice benches and plenty of balls around and a water fountain. It is very clean i.e. no dog which is rare. The only draw back is that the big dog area is covered in wood chips and my dog doesn't really like to run in it.
